如何创建进度条
可能的使用场景
在Excel中创建进度条的主要原因是将原始数字转化为一目了然的视觉指标,简化复杂数据,一目了然。
-
增强视觉清晰度和即时洞察:像“75%”、“8/10”或“15000/20000”这样的数字表格需要认知努力来解读。进度条让任何人,从高级经理到团队成员,都能立即理解状态、表现或完成程度,无需读取和处理数字。
-
快速识别状态和趋势:我们的脑部被编码为比文本更快处理长度和颜色的视觉信息。你可以快速看到:什么在正常范围内?(长的绿色条)、什么落后了?(短的红色条)以及什么几乎完成?(几乎满的条)。这加快了决策和优先级的制定。
-
改善仪表盘和报告:进度条是有效仪表盘的基石。它们使报告更具吸引力、更专业且更易于展示。带有关键绩效指标(KPIs)进度条的仪表盘比满是数字的表格更具效果。
-
激励和绩效追踪:对于销售团队、项目追踪器或个人目标,直观的进度展示能极大提升动力。随着条形逐渐填充,带来清晰且令人满意的成就感。
-
高效沟通:在会议或演示中,进度条比说“我们已达季度目标的72.5%”更有效地传达信息。视觉效果在表达上更直观,节省时间,避免误解。
如何在Excel中创建进度条
在Excel中创建进度条是一种很好的方式,能够直观显示任务完成情况、项目进度或数据趋势。以下是使用不同方法创建的方法指南,并提供一些定制建议。
使用条件格式(数据条)
- 准备数据:至少有一列显示进度的值,理想为百分比(例如,0.5 表示50%)。可以用公式如 =Current_Value/Target_Value 计算。
- 选中单元格:高亮显示包含百分比值的单元格。
- 应用数据条:转到“开始”选项卡 > “条件格式” > “数据条”。选择渐变填充或纯色填充。
- 自定义(可选):如果需要更多控制,转到“条件格式” > “管理规则” > “编辑规则”。
- 将最小值和最大值类型设置为“数字”,值分别为0和1,确保正确显示0-100%。
- 在此处调整颜色和边框样式。要同时显示数字和条形,请编辑规则并确保“仅显示条形”未被选中。
使用REPT函数(基于文本的条形)
- 输入公式:在一个单元格中使用类似=REPT(“█”, B210) & REPT(“░”, 10 - B210)的公式,其中B2包含进度百分比。此示例创建一个10字符宽的条:用实心方块(█)表示完成,用浅色方块(░)表示剩余。
- 调整和格式化:根据想要的长度调整倍数(例如,为20字符宽的条设置*20)。使用等宽字体如Courier New以确保对齐。
使用图表(用于仪表盘)
- 构建数据:创建一个表格来计算数值:
数字 A B 1 进度 剩余 2 =当前值/目标值 =1-A2 - 插入图表:选择数据 > 插入选项卡 > 图表 > 2D 堆积条形图。
- 格式化图表:移除图表标题、图例和网格线以保持整洁。右键点击“剩余”数据系列 > 格式数据系列 > 填充 > 无填充。右键点击“进度”系列 > 格式数据系列 > 将系列重叠调整为100%,“间隙宽度”设为0%。调整横轴:设置边界 > 最小值为0,最大值为1。
如何在Aspose.Cells中创建进度条
使用REPT函数(基于文本的条形)创建进度条
请参阅以下示例代码。它创建一个新的工作簿并添加一些示例数据。然后基于初始数据添加REPT函数(基于文本的条形)。最后,将工作簿保存为xlsx文件。以下截图显示Aspose.Cells在输出Excel文件中创建的条件格式(数据条)。

使用条件格式(数据条)创建进度条
请参阅以下示例代码。它创建一个新的工作簿并添加一些示例数据。然后根据初始数据添加条件格式(数据条)并设置相关属性。最后,将工作簿保存为xlsx文件。以下截图显示Aspose.Cells在输出Excel文件中创建的条件格式(数据条)。

用堆积条图创建进度条
请参阅以下示例代码。它加载包含一些样例数据的示例Excel文件,然后基于初始数据创建堆积条形图,并设置相关属性。最后,保存工作簿为输出的XLSX格式。以下截图显示Aspose.Cells在输出Excel文件中创建的进度条。